技术文摘
如何备份 MySQL 数据库
如何备份MySQL数据库
在当今数字化时代,数据是企业和个人的重要资产。对于使用MySQL数据库的用户来说,定期备份数据库至关重要,它能防止数据丢失,确保业务的连续性。以下将详细介绍几种常见的备份方法。
一、使用 mysqldump 命令行工具
这是最常用的备份方式。打开命令提示符,输入特定命令即可实现备份。语法通常为:mysqldump -u [用户名] -p [数据库名] > [备份文件名.sql]。例如,要备份名为“testdb”的数据库,用户名为“root”,可在命令行输入:mysqldump -u root -p testdb > testdb_backup.sql。执行命令后,系统会提示输入密码,输入正确密码后,备份文件便会生成在指定路径。该方法简单灵活,适合备份小型到中型规模的数据库。
二、使用MySQL Enterprise Backup
这是MySQL官方提供的企业级备份解决方案,具备高效、可靠的特点。它支持热备份,即在数据库运行时进行备份,不影响正常业务操作。使用该工具,首先要确保已安装MySQL Enterprise Backup软件。备份时,需根据实际情况配置备份参数,如备份路径、日志记录等。其操作相对复杂,但功能强大,能满足大型企业对数据备份的严格要求。
三、使用phpMyAdmin进行备份
若你的服务器环境支持phpMyAdmin,那么通过它备份数据库非常便捷。登录phpMyAdmin界面,在左侧选择要备份的数据库,点击“导出”选项卡。在导出设置页面,可选择备份格式,如SQL、CSV等,还能设置是否压缩备份文件等参数。设置完毕后,点击“执行”按钮,即可将备份文件下载到本地。此方法适合对技术操作不太熟悉的用户。
无论选择哪种备份方式,都要养成定期备份的习惯,并将备份文件存储在安全的位置,如外部存储设备或云端存储。这样,即使遇到硬件故障、软件错误或人为误操作,也能迅速恢复数据,减少损失。
- HTML5转独立安卓应用程序
- Vue实现图片马赛克与模糊效果的方法
- Vue 与 jsmind 如何实现思维导图节点间关联及依赖管理
- Anime.js 的 JavaScript 动画深度剖析第二部分:参数详细解读
- JavaScript 中 some() 方法的用途
- Vue项目中借助jsmind实现思维导图全文搜索与替换的方法
- 如何解决 Vue 中 Missing required prop 错误
- JavaScript 实现马尔可夫矩阵程序
- JavaScript 中如何创建带数字的动态长度数组并求数字之和
- Vue 统计图表 3D 立体与旋转效果的优化提升
- JavaScript 中 parseInt() 方法的作用
- Vue报错:v-for指令列表渲染无法正确使用如何解决
- JavaScript 程序:查找链表长度
- 解决[Vue warn]: Invalid prop: update value错误的方法
- clearfix是什么